Art is political, creating art is political, and access to art is political. With the exhibition “MutualArt” we aim to present a diverse range of art media and art forms through a collaboration between various groups and individuals in Freiburg!
From lectures, drawings, photographs, concerts, readings, and performances—there’s truly something for everyone!
There is no overarching theme here; instead, the idea is to create an exhibition that is as accessible, autonomous, and intersectional as possible, where the exhibitors themselves decide on their own framework and theme. It is an attempt to showcase art and contributions from, in particular, BiPOC, TIN* individuals, queer people, people with disabilities, and those who face greater barriers to accessing exhibition spaces.

Accessibility:
The restrooms are located on the first basement level of the building, accessible via a staircase, and unfortunately are not wheelchair-accessible; we are currently working on a solution for this.
The exhibition space is located right next to a major road, which means it can get a bit noisy outside. A large lawn next to the building can be used to find some peace and quiet. If needed we can find a way so that you can rest in a studio space at Hujimaja.
